What is the NMFC code 50570?
NMFC code 50570 belongs to freight group 50500 and is described as: Conduits or Conduit Connections, for underground work, cement, clay, concrete or terra cotta, single or multiple cell, lined or not lined
Class: 60

Understanding Freight Class 60
NMFC code 50570 is classified as Freight Class 60.
- Typical Density: 30-35 lbs/cu ft
- Common Items: Car parts, car accessories, cast iron stoves
Freight class affects shipping rates - lower classes (50-85) typically have lower rates, while higher classes (150-500) have higher rates due to factors like density, stowability, handling, and liability.
